The first Swiss cheese in the United States was made about 1850 by Swiss immigrants, and much of it is still being made by their descendants. In the United States Swiss cheese is often called Schweizer or Sweitzer …

Switzerland produces over 475 varieties of cheese, a milk-based food produced in a large range of flavors, textures, and forms. Cow's milk is used in about 99 percent of the cheeses Switzerland produces. SpletCheese is produced in Switzerland in about 600 cheese dairies. These range from smaller, family-run alpine farms to large industrial operations. Each year, cheese dairies produce more than 190,000 tons of cheese.
